In many countries in the Global South, a continuum of land systems and tenure regimes is observed, ranging from the most informal (unregistered occupation) to the most formal (certificate or title). At the turn of the 21st century, a general trend towards the formalization of land tenure and the need for enhanced security of land rights has emerged. The land issue has thus become strategic and is now central to sustainable development processes. It is now established that good land governance positively influences economic development, social cohesion, food security, and poverty reduction. This dynamic leads to land reforms aimed at recognizing and protecting land rights, identifying best practices for land rights registration and transfer, and ensuring that land administration systems are accessible and affordable.
Geographic information is an essential component, through the collection and updating of cadastral data. The development of Land Information Systems (LIS) integrates not only these geographic components but also the various modules related to land registry management.
